Get Free AccessThe process of vapor cavity formation in light absorbing liquid under the action of free- running laser radiation is investigated and a mathematical model to simulate the process is presented. To minimize thermal and mechanical damage of tissue, it is proposed to choose an appropriate temporal profile and energy of laser pulses using results of the simulation.
Alexander S. Silenok, R. Steiner, Manfred M. Fischer, Karl Stock, Raimund Hibst, В. И. Конов (1992). Bubble formation in light-absorbing liquid. Proceedings of SPIE, the International Society for Optical Engineering/Proceedings of SPIE, 1646, pp. 322-322, DOI: 10.1117/12.137475.
